The Changing Landscape:
Europe has long been at the forefront of environmental initiatives and regulations, driving the need for improved waste management systems. The European Union’s Circular Economy Action Plan and Green Deal have set ambitious targets for reducing waste and increasing recycling rates, which has a direct impact on the garbage bins market.
Sustainable Practices:
One of the most significant trends in the European garbage bins market is the emphasis on sustainability. Manufacturers are now producing bins made from recycled materials and designing them for easy recycling at the end of their life cycle. This focus on circularity aligns with the EU’s goals of reducing waste and promoting resource efficiency.
Smart and Innovative Solutions:
The rise of smart cities and the Internet of Things (IoT) has spurred innovation in garbage bins. Smart bins equipped with sensors and communication technology are becoming more common, allowing waste management companies to optimize collection routes, reduce costs, and minimize environmental impact. These bins can alert authorities when they need emptying, reducing unnecessary truck emissions.

Urbanization and Population Growth:
Europe is experiencing urbanization at an unprecedented rate, with more people living in cities than ever before. This demographic shift has led to increased waste generation, necessitating larger and more efficient garbage bins. The market has responded by producing larger capacity bins and developing compact designs suitable for urban environments.
Regulatory Environment:
Stringent waste management regulations in Europe have placed a greater emphasis on waste segregation and recycling. This has led to the demand for specialized bins for different types of waste, such as organic, recyclable, and non-recyclable materials. Manufacturers are developing color-coded and labeled bins to facilitate proper waste sorting.
Hygiene and Health Concerns:
The COVID-19 pandemic has heightened awareness of hygiene and sanitation. Garbage bins with features like foot-operated lids and antimicrobial coatings are gaining popularity in public spaces and healthcare facilities. These bins help reduce the spread of diseases and maintain a cleaner environment.
Challenges:
While the Europe garbage bins market offers promising opportunities, it also faces several challenges. These include:
a. Cost of Innovation: Developing smart bins and eco-friendly materials can be expensive, which may limit adoption, particularly among smaller municipalities.
b. Waste Collection Infrastructure: Some regions in Europe still lack adequate waste collection infrastructure, hindering the adoption of advanced garbage bins.
c. Resistance to Change: Resistance to change and traditional waste management practices can slow down the transition to more sustainable solutions.
